RANGELY, Colo. - The 17th-ranked College of Southern Idaho Volleyball Team cruised to the quick 25-7, 25-16, 25-9 win over Scenic West Athletic Conference opponent Colorado Northwestern Friday.
The Golden Eagles hit .407, finishing the match with just eight hitting errors.
Leading the way was
Isabel Smart, finishing with 15 kills and eight digs.
Mina Benucci added seven and
Ava Pond,
Vivian Goto and
Zeynep Balci each had five kills. Balci also had three blocks.
Hazuna Akishige finished with a double-double, posting 10 assists and 11 digs.
Dalayni Brindley had a team-high 20 assists along with eight digs.
CSI, 15-7 overall and 4-2 in conference play, takes on 5th-ranked Salt Lake CC Saturday at 1 p.m. at Mountain Ridge High School. The Bruins gym suffered a waterline break so the game was moved to a local high school.
